Mills Original Potetmos is a iconic Norwegian food product that has become a staple in many households across the country. The brand, Mills, was founded in 1885 in Grünerløkka, Oslo, originally starting as a margarine factory under the name Christiania Smørfabrik. Over the decades, the company expanded its portfolio to include various condiments and food products, including their popular instant mashed potatoes made from real Norwegian potatoes.
Today, the Mills brand is owned by Agra AS, a major Norwegian food group with a strong presence in the Scandinavian market. The product is primarily manufactured in Norway, utilizing local ingredients and maintaining a long-standing tradition of quality. As a privately held family business, Agra AS oversees the production and distribution of Mills products, ensuring the brand remains a central part of Norwegian culinary culture well into 2026 and beyond.
